Historical Significance and Design
The Rolex Explorer was first introduced in 1953, making it one of the oldest models in the brand’s collection. Its design was inspired by the adventures of explorers like Sir Edmund Hillary and Tenzing Norgay, who conquered Mount Everest in 1953. The Explorer’s robust construction and functional features made it an ideal choice for explorers and adventurers, solidifying its reputation as a reliable and durable timepiece.
